Amidst a backdrop of centuries-old family feuds, Mary and Ben unexpectedly rekindle their forbidden romance, unleashing a wave of escalating violence. As long-standing debts and bitter grudges come to light, a diverse group of characters becomes entangled in the conflict. These include Ben's steadfast friend Mukul, Mary's troubled stalker Terrence, and an unusual pair consisting of Australian hitman Wayne and his unconventional partner Barbie. The rekindled affair sets in motion a series of dangerous confrontations and unexpected alliances.

  1. The Duel Begins

    In 1864 New York City, a longstanding rivalry between Tarleton Rathcart and Theodore Gibbon culminates in a dramatic Gentlemen's Duel. This showdown results in the tragic death of Theodore, igniting a bitter and lasting feud between their families.

  2. Benjamin's Struggles

    Benjamin Gibbon, a young man plagued by depression, becomes increasingly involved in fights, reflecting his inner turmoil and reckless behavior. Despite this chaos, his life takes a turn when he falls for Mary Rathcart, bringing hope but also complexities to his life.

  3. Mary's Expulsion

    Mary Rathcart faces the consequences of her romantic involvement with Benjamin, resulting in her expulsion from every private school she attended. Her love for Ben stands defiant against her parents’ disapproval, pushing her to pursue their relationship amidst the family feud.

  4. Separation

    In a bid to separate Mary from Benjamin, her parents send her off to a boarding school overseas. Despite the distance, they attempt to maintain their relationship through letters and phone calls, though many of these go unanswered due to her father's interference.

  5. Mary Returns

    Years later, Mary returns from Paris, and Benjamin, eager to reconnect, decides to crash a party at the Rathcart estate. However, he is quickly confronted by Mary’s parents, who remind him of the restraining order against him, leading to a hasty exit.

  6. Terrence's Dark Deal

    William Rathcart hires Terrence Uberahl for a perilous job following a scandal involving Pamela Corbett-Ragsdale. Terrence, infatuated with Mary during her time abroad, offers a sinister proposal: eliminate Corbett-Ragsdale in exchange for marrying Mary.

  7. An Unexpected Reunion

    Determined to regain Mary's affection, Benjamin finds himself in a confrontation with Wayne McCarthy and his wife, Barbie. Despite attempts to avoid the clash, he ends up in a fight that leads to an unexpected and intimate moment with Mary in his apartment.

  8. Plans for Marriage

    After their heartfelt conversation, Benjamin and Mary acknowledge that their love has remained strong through the years. This revelation leads them to make immediate plans to marry, eager to leave behind the turmoil that has plagued their families.

  9. Violent Confrontation

    The romantic reunion is shattered when Terrence sends Wayne to intimidate Benjamin. Armed for a confrontation, Wayne and Barbie cause a violent altercation in Ben's apartment, culminating in an accidental death that escalates the chaos surrounding them.

  10. Terrence's Success

    Amidst the rising conflict, Terrence manages to kill Corbett-Ragsdale, solidifying his dark reputation. As he learns of Ben and Mary’s engagement, the tension reaches a boiling point, leading to an explosive confrontation.

  11. The Final Standoff

    In a shocking culmination of events, Terrence confronts Benjamin as Wayne arrives alongside William. Gunfire erupts amidst the chaotic scene, resulting in Wayne being shot by the police and allowing Terrence a chance to take aim at Ben.

  12. Mukul's Bravery

    Faced with the escalating violence, Mukul steps in to protect Ben and confronts Terrence in a valiant effort. Unfortunately, his courage comes at a cost as he is ultimately killed by a shot fired by Mary in her desperate attempt to save Benjamin.

  13. A Dream Realized

    The film culminates with Benjamin and Mary escaping the chaos surrounding them. Driving off into the sunset towards Mexico, they finally pursue the long-awaited dream they had nurtured for so long, symbolizing a new beginning.
